BEIJING, Feb. 27, 2017 -- ChinaCache International Holdings Ltd. ("ChinaCache" or the "Company") (Nasdaq:CCIH), the leading total solutions provider of Internet content and application delivery services in China, today announced it has entered into an exclusive partnership with PacketZoom, the leading provider of in-app technology that boosts mobile app performance. Pursuant to the agreement, ChinaCache is granted exclusive right in China to build mobile-friendly infrastructure to deliver Packet Zoom Expresslanes™ aimed to accelerate and improve the reliability of mobile app content delivery in China. The term of partnership is initially three years and is subject to renewal.
“We are pleased to establish this partnership with PacketZoom,” said Mr. Song Wang, Chairman and Chief Executive Officer of ChinaCache. "As a leading provider of enterprise CDN solutions for mobile apps across China, we strive to ensure the optimal mobile user experience for our customers. We are excited this partnership allows us to speed up mobile apps over evolving cellular networks and improve the user experience for popular local apps as well as global apps operating in China.”
“With almost 1.3 billion mobile users in some of the most densely populated cities globally, it's no surprise that mobile user experience has become a priority for content providers,” said Shlomi Gian, CEO of PacketZoom. “The combination of PacketZoom’s Mobile Expresslanes™ for last mile optimization with ChinaCache edge servers and middle mile optimization is the ideal solution for optimal mobile app experience - especially in crowded markets where networks can be overworked.”
About ChinaCache International Holdings Ltd.
ChinaCache International Holdings Ltd. (Nasdaq:CCIH) is the leading total solutions provider of Internet content and application delivery services in China. As a carrier-neutral service provider, ChinaCache's network in China is interconnected with networks operated by all telecom carriers, major non-carriers and local Internet service providers. With more than a decade of experience in developing solutions tailored to China's complex Internet infrastructure, ChinaCache is a partner of choice for businesses, government agencies and other enterprises to enhance the reliability and scalability of online services and applications and improve end-user experience. About PacketZoom
PacketZoom’s SDK redefines mobile performance via in-app networking technology, customized for each user. By removing roadblocks in the mobile last mile, PacketZoom is able to significantly accelerate performance by 2x to 3x, rescue up to 80% of the sessions from TCP connection drop and reduce CDN costs. PacketZoom helps mobile publishers boost app performance worldwide by accelerating and improving reliability of content delivery. For more information:www.packetzoom.com.
